“…(1) OVERVIEW INTRODUCTION Social media data can provide insights into people's perception or preferences of specific topics [13], and thus have the possibility to impact many aspects of our society such as policies and infrastructure designs [1]. While getting a representative sample is often difficult or sometimes impossible [2,6,7,10,14], the text data available in platforms like Twitter can be valuable for research, especially given that many entities, from politicians and companies to influential individuals, use this platform to spread ideas, strategies, plans, and proposals.…”
